The video tutorial covers the basics of alcohols, including their structure, classification, and uses. Alcohols are organic molecules with a hydroxyl group, and they can be classified as primary, secondary, or tertiary based on the position of the OH group. The video explains the general formula of alcohols and their properties, such as polarity and boiling points, which are influenced by hydrogen bonding. It also discusses the uses of alcohols in various industries, highlighting ethanol's role as a beverage and antiseptic. By the end of the tutorial, viewers should be able to identify alcohols, name them, understand their uses, and categorize them correctly.
